How Much Do General Psychology Graduates from University of Southern Mississippi Make?

$32,661 Bachelor's Median Salary

Salary of General Psychology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

General Psychology students who finish a bachelor’s at University of Southern Mississippi earn a median of $32,661 a year. This is below $51,802, the median for all majors at University of Southern Mississippi.

How Much Student Debt Do General Psychology Graduates from University of Southern Mississippi Have?

$22,685 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of General Psychology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

Earning a bachelor’s degree at University of Southern Mississippi, general psychology students accumulate a median of $22,685 in student loans. This is lower than $25,231, the typical median for all majors at University of Southern Mississippi.

University of Southern Mississippi General Psychology Bachelor’s Program Diversity

Among recent graduates, 22% of general psychology bachelor’s degrees went to men and 78% went to women.

University of Southern Mississippi gender breakdown of General Psychology Bachelor's degree grads

The largest share of general psychology bachelor’s degree graduates at University of Southern Mississippi were White. About 55%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from University of Southern Mississippi with a bachelor’s in general psychology.

Ethnic diversity of General Psychology majors at University of Southern Mississippi
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 1
Black or African American 55
Hispanic or Latino 10
White 94
Non-Resident Aliens 1
Other Races 11
